Assembler/Computer Operator

We are currently looking to hire people to assemble, disassemble and replace parts on laptop computers.

Successful candidates will have experience with computers, able to organize and control defective products. Must be proficient with Notebook and Windows OS as well as Word and Excel.

These positions are Monday – Friday 8:00-4:30 plus overtime  pay range is $12.00 per hour.
